Immune Reconstitution Inflammatory Syndrome (IRIS) and Paradoxical Upgrading Reactions
This research theme addresses the need for better scientific understanding of risk factors for, and the pathogenesis of, paradoxical upgrading reactions (PUR) in HIV-uninfected people. Such understanding is a necessary first step to developing new tools to identify those at risk and develop interventions to prevent and treat this common complication of anti-TB therapy. This work builds on a longstanding program of research on pathogenesis and treatment of HIV-associated TB Immune Reconstitution Inflammatory Syndrome (TB-IRIS), led by Graeme Meintjes.
